def pca_amplitude_3s(
mtx_abc: np.ndarray, order: bool = True
) -> tuple[float, float, np.ndarray]:
"""
Relative amplitudes between triplet of S-waves.
Given waveforms of three events, determine which two waveforms :math:`b` and
:math:`c` are most different from each other and compute the relative
amplitudes :math:`B^{abc}` and :math:`B^{acb}` that predict the third
waveform :math:'u_a', such that:
.. math::
B^{abc} u_b + B^{acb} * u_c = u_a
Parameters
----------
mtx_abc:
Waveform matrix of shape ``(3, samples)`` holding events `a`, `b` and
`c`
order:
If True, order the waveforms by pairwise summed cross-correlation
coefficients before computing the relative amplitudes. If False, use
the order of the input matrix.
Returns
-------
Babc:
Relative ampltiude between event `a` and `b`, given the third event is `c`
Bacb:
Relative ampltiude between event `a` and `c`, given the third event is `b`
iord:
Resulting ``(3,)`` row indices into `mtx_abc` of events `a`, `b` and `c`
sigmas:
``(3,)`` first three singular values of the seismogram decomposition
"""
iord = np.array([0, 1, 2])
if order:
iord = order_by_ccsum(mtx_abc)
_, ss, Vh = svd(mtx_abc.T / np.max(abs(mtx_abc)), full_matrices=False)
sigmas = ss[:3] / np.sum(ss)
# Bostock et al. (2021) Eq. 10
# Expansion coefficients
ecs = np.diag(ss) @ Vh
# Pull out expansion coefficients b, c...
# (LHS Eq. 10)
A = ecs[0:2, iord[1:]]
# ... and a
# (RHS Eq. 10)
bb = ecs[0:2, iord[0]]
if bb[1] == 0:
logger.warning("All wavefroms are similar, so treated with Bacb = 0")
return bb[0], 0.0, iord, sigmas
else:
try:
Babc, Bacb = solve(A, bb)
except LinAlgError as e:
msg = f"Met error in SVD: {e.__repr__()}. Do you have null data? "
msg += "Returning NaNs."
logger.warning(msg)
return np.nan, np.nan, iord, sigmas
return Babc, Bacb, iord, sigmas

def s_misfit(mtx_abc: np.ndarray, Babc: float, Bacb: float) -> float:
"""
Misfit of the S waveform reconstruction
The residual norm of the reconstruction devided by the norm of the predicted
waveform :math:`u_a`:
.. math::
\\Psi_S = || B^{abc} u_b + B^{acb} u_c - u_a || / || u_a ||
Parameters
----------
mtx_abc:
Waveform matrix of shape ``(3, samples)`` holding events `a`, `b` and
`c`
Babc:
Relative ampltiude between event `a` and `b`, given the third event is `c`
Bacb:
Relative ampltiude between event `a` and `c`, given the third event is `b`
Returns
-------
Normalized reconstruction misfit
"""
try:
return norm(Babc * mtx_abc[1, :] + Bacb * mtx_abc[2, :] - mtx_abc[0, :]) / norm(
mtx_abc[0, :]
)
except ValueError:
return np.nan
[docs]
def order_by_ccsum(mtx_abc: np.ndarray) -> np.ndarray:
"""
Order waveforms by pairwise summed cross-correlation coefficients
Parameters
----------
mtx_abc:
Waveform of shape ``(3, samples)`` of events `a`, `b`, and `c`
Returns
-------
iord: :class:`~numpy.ndarray`
Indices ``(3,)`` that order :math:`u_a, u_b, u_c` by cc
"""
# Calculate cross-correlation coefficients between all pairs of waveforms
ab = abs(signal.cc_coef(mtx_abc[0, :], mtx_abc[1, :]))
ac = abs(signal.cc_coef(mtx_abc[0, :], mtx_abc[2, :]))
bc = abs(signal.cc_coef(mtx_abc[1, :], mtx_abc[2, :]))
# Re-order events based on waveform similarity such that evs B and C are most different
iord = np.argsort([ab + ac, ab + bc, ac + bc])[::-1]
return iord
